      <description>&lt;P&gt;I have had my BCP for some time now. Few years or so. Today I decided to apply for the Hilton Aspire. Got approved. Happy, thought all was well. Then I noticed that my BCP CL was dropped from 22K down to 12K. After being approved for 15K on the Hilton card. Has anyone else experienced this? To be honest I'm a little bummed about getting dropped 10K off my limit. Thoughts?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;I have heard many others share a similar experience. That made me a little hesitant to ask for a CLI when my Bonvoy was at 20k, my aspire 24k, and my BCP at 8k. I have never asked for a CLI with my BCP; had it about 14 months. My Bonvoy had an initial cl of 20k so after about 10 months I decided to go for it. They immediately said they wanted to see some bank statements and said it could take up to 10 days for an answer. After about 10 days I finally heard they had approved my cl for 40k. No other limits were changed. Im glad they asked for bank statements rather than dilute my credit limits. I also have a platinum card.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;hard to see a pattern here&lt;/P&gt;</description>
